Why did Pomelo reduce its workforce?
Pomelo streamlined its processes to move towards more sustainable growth. The company stated this in response to queries about the job cuts, which affected 8% of its headcount.

What is Pomelo's current financial situation regarding external capital?
Pomelo is in the process of raising external capital and has engaged banks like Morgan Stanley for assistance. It secured about $10 million from existing investors in August, adding to a total of at least $83 million raised previously.

Where does Pomelo operate its business?
Pomelo, launched in 2013, sells clothing and accessories online and through its retail stores. Its operations are based in Thailand, Singapore, Indonesia, and Malaysia.

What wider trend in Southeast Asia is Pomelo's situation part of?
Pomelo is among regional peers trying to reduce cash burn as investors are less willing to fund growth without profits. Many e-commerce companies face slower growth due to souring macroeconomic conditions and reduced consumer spending.
